Skip to main content

A CLI tool to record SIGNATE competition scores to W&B

Project description

signate-wandb-sync

A CLI tool to record SIGNATE competition scores to Weights & Biases (W&B).

Installation

pip install signate-wandb-sync

Usage

score — Log SIGNATE scores to W&B

After submitting to SIGNATE and getting your score, record it to a W&B run:

# Full W&B URL
signate-wandb-sync score https://wandb.ai/your-entity/your-project/runs/abc123 --score 0.85 --rank 3

# With additional metrics
signate-wandb-sync score https://wandb.ai/your-entity/your-project/runs/abc123 \
    --score 0.85 --rank 3 \
    -m fbeta=0.85 -m recall=0.91

# Using bare run ID (requires --project)
signate-wandb-sync score abc123 --project your-entity/your-project --score 0.85

Options

Option Description
--score SIGNATE submission score (float)
--rank Leaderboard rank (int)
--metric KEY=VALUE Additional metric (repeatable)
--project entity/project W&B project path (for bare run IDs)

Windows

PYTHONUTF8=1 signate-wandb-sync score <run_id> --score 0.85

Authentication

W&B: run wandb login beforehand (or set WANDB_API_KEY environment variable).

Requirements

License

MIT

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

signate_wandb_sync-0.1.0.tar.gz (4.4 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

signate_wandb_sync-0.1.0-py3-none-any.whl (5.5 kB view details)

Uploaded Python 3

File details

Details for the file signate_wandb_sync-0.1.0.tar.gz.

File metadata

  • Download URL: signate_wandb_sync-0.1.0.tar.gz
  • Upload date:
  • Size: 4.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for signate_wandb_sync-0.1.0.tar.gz
Algorithm Hash digest
SHA256 1abe255cb8a1f28edcb9e2b8af179b6b46904b51ae1edb7295c3b75077243884
MD5 522cebc986e6faa22e55e8ccfa745dc2
BLAKE2b-256 cb0e707e6924e62e4715b9913ad2e8dacefcc3957941df4776c2cdbceb287ffd

See more details on using hashes here.

Provenance

The following attestation bundles were made for signate_wandb_sync-0.1.0.tar.gz:

Publisher: publish.yml on yasumorishima/signate-wandb-sync

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file signate_wandb_sync-0.1.0-py3-none-any.whl.

File metadata

File hashes

Hashes for signate_wandb_sync-0.1.0-py3-none-any.whl
Algorithm Hash digest
SHA256 4232e5c579753a8710067011d26d9982b97cccbf92d79b3dffc2209e3bbc50d2
MD5 032948057b10648f6358a32872132040
BLAKE2b-256 9726dfb9d9b0fba5c6723786110afed9f520ab448dbc193da9d5b2482ce4e2d9

See more details on using hashes here.

Provenance

The following attestation bundles were made for signate_wandb_sync-0.1.0-py3-none-any.whl:

Publisher: publish.yml on yasumorishima/signate-wandb-sync

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page